TCS Q4 Highlights: Revenue ₹64,479 Cr, Profit ₹12,224 Cr, Record $12.2 Bn Deals Won, ₹30 Dividend Announced

On 10 April 2025, Tata Consultancy Services (TCS), the largest IT services exporter in India, released its Q4 FY25 earnings. The quarter marked a historic achievement as the company's revenues surpassed $30 billion for the full year. However, the Q4 results were slightly below market expectations due to global economic volatility and cautious client spending patterns. Despite headwinds, TCS was able to demonstrate resilience through strong deal closings, continued investment in innovation, and steady margins.

Death Penalty in India

Did you know? India’s first female execution after independence in 1955 was of Rattan Bhai Jain—for poisoning three girls and killing them. As of today, more than 500+ prisoners in India are on death row, and the primary method of execution? Still hanging by the neck until death. But here’s the twist—Despite hundreds on death row, India has carried out only 8 executions since 2000—making it a rare punishment in practice as well.

Understanding NCLT and NCLAT in Corporate Disputes

The National Company Law Tribunal (NCLT) and National Company Law Appellate Tribunal (NCLAT) are the two important judicial bodies in India’s corporate justice landscape. These tribunal bodies were established under the Companies Act, 2013, to handle the disputes and issues under the ambit of Companies Act, IBC and other issues related to companies.

CLAT UG 2025 Result Out: What after CLAT 2025 Result?

The Consortium of National Law Universities declared the CLAT 2025 results on 7 December 2024. Along with the results, the CLAT 2025 final answer key has also been released. The overall attendance percentage for CLAT 2025 was 96.33%. Of the candidates who appeared for CLAT 2025, 57% are Females, 43% are Males, and 9 candidates are Transgender.
